Discover your opportunities at Yale!</p> <p>Overview</p> <p>Reporting to the Associate Controller of Operations Finance and Administration, the Assistant Controller provides leadership and oversight for all finance operations and related administrative functions across multiple Operations units at Yale University. The position is responsible for ensuring the accurate, timely, and compliant execution of financial operations in alignment with university policies, regulatory requirements, and internal control standards.</p> <p>The Assistant Controller establishes and maintains accounting principles, practices, procedures, and controls that support consistent financial operations across units. This role ensures that all finance operations activities are conducted in compliance with university standards and applicable regulations, with appropriate consideration for internal and external audits and financial reporting requirements.</p> <p>Serving as the primary point of contact for finance operations matters within assigned Operations units, the Assistant Controller provides guidance and resolution for complex accounting, transactional, and compliance issues. The role partners closely with unit leadership, central finance, and university service providers to support effective operations and mitigate financial and operational risk.</p> <p>The Assistant Controller oversees teams responsible for day-to-day financial transactions, financial systems, and internal controls across multiple Operations units, as well as centralized functions supporting Operations broadly. Areas of oversight include accounting and journal entries, payroll processing, invoice and contract purchase order management, billing and accounts receivable, inventory and cash handling, tax reporting, financial compliance activities, audit support, and reconciliation of University Service Provider rates.</p> <p>In addition to financial operations, the Assistant Controller oversees key administrative functions that support Operations units, including onboarding and offboarding, system and IT access approvals, staff training and support, space management coordination, and sponsored ID approvals.</p> <p>This role carries broad leadership responsibility with an emphasis on operational excellence, risk management, process improvement, and consistency across Operations. All responsibilities are performed with a focus on strong internal controls, audit readiness, and the integrity of university financial reporting.</p> <p>The Assistant Controller also serves as a deputy to the Associate Controller, supporting operations-wide finance initiatives, cross-unit projects, and continuous improvement efforts. The position is expected to contribute to the ongoing development and expansion of capabilities within the Operations Finance and Administration organization.</p> <p>Required Skills and Abilities</p> <p>1.Comprehensive knowledge of financial accounting, reporting, and internal control concepts.</p> <p>2.Collaborative, strategic, adaptable and effective under pressure with strong leadership skills and a track record of accomplishment.
